A Watsonville gang leader accused of murder is being held on $1 million bail after the district attorney told a judge that Jose Velasquez and other gang members stabbed a man 80 times, then left his bloody body near a Pajaro Valley berry field.
District Attorney Bob Lee gave new details about the gruesome killing during the first court appearance for Velasquez, 25, one of two Watsonville men who have been arrested and charged with murdering Oscar Avalos Sanchez, 35, and dumping his body off Carlton Road earlier this month.
"The facts of this case include 80 stabbings," Lee said. "It was almost to the point of torture."
All of the 80 stabs punctured Sanchez's sweatshirt, 60 penetrated his undershirt and 40 went into his skin, Lee said. Several were mortal.
Sheriff's Office detectives have said Velasquez and Alejandro Chavez, 22, are equally responsible for killing Sanchez, who was an acquaintance, on Jan. 6. Chavez was arrested last week in Missouri and is expected to be extradited to California next week.
